Agree with Shipo. I've had my 300C RWD for 3 yrs now & there is plenty of snow where I live. The OEM Conti's are just plain horrible in snow -- but with a set of 4 winter tires the car is very good indeed -- pulls like a tractor in deep snow & stable & secure with the ESP active -- just the ticket for getting the groceries on a nasty day. However, the real fun comes with the ESP off -- long power slides & a quick flick of the tail with a twitch of throttle. The car is very well balanced, responds crisply to steering inputs and has a big critical steering angle -- so you can really get it sideways & easily pull it back. I haven't had fun like this since my T-Bird Super Coupe. I hate front drivers in the snow -- boring snow plows.
